What to Evaluate Before Engaging This Auditor
Before signing an engagement letter with any SOC 2 auditor, take time to verify the following. These factors apply broadly but are worth confirming for each firm on your shortlist.
Credentials and Standing
Confirm the firm holds an active CPA license in good standing. Only licensed CPA firms can issue SOC 2 reports.
Scope and Deliverables
Clarify what the engagement includes: readiness assessment, gap remediation support, the audit itself, and the final report. Understand what falls outside the scope.
Timeline and Availability
Ask for a written timeline from kickoff through report delivery. Understand the observation period requirements and how auditor capacity could affect scheduling.
Pricing Transparency
Ask whether fees are fixed or billed hourly, what triggers additional charges, and whether the quote includes all phases of the engagement.

Factors that affect SOC 2 audit cost
Audit type
Type I audits (point-in-time) are generally less expensive than Type II audits (operating effectiveness over 3 to 12 months).
Company size and complexity
Larger companies with more systems, employees, and data flows require broader audit scope and more evidence collection.
Industry and regulatory overlaps
Industries with additional frameworks (HIPAA, PCI DSS, FedRAMP) often require expanded scoping and cross-mapping.
Readiness assessment
Some firms bundle a readiness gap analysis; others charge separately. A readiness phase can reduce surprises during fieldwork.
Compliance platform usage
Using platforms like Drata, Vanta, or Secureframe can reduce evidence collection time, which may lower auditor fees.
Timeline urgency
Fast-track or expedited audits often carry premium pricing due to scheduling and resource allocation constraints.
